Acadia Healthcare Company, Inc. is an American provider of for-profit behavioral healthcare services. It operates a network of over 225 facilities across the United States and Puerto Rico.

Gray Media, Inc. is an American publicly traded television broadcasting company based in Atlanta. Founded in 1946 by James Harrison Gray as Gray Communications Systems, the company is the third-largest television station operator in the United States by number of stations, owning or operating 180 stations across the United States in 113 markets. Its station base consists of media markets ranging from as large as Atlanta to one of the smallest markets, North Platte, Nebraska.
